Brown content with Well show
16 Jul 2010 - 12:42:21
Motherwell manager Craig Brown was content with his side's 1-0 victory at home to Icelanders Breidablik in the first leg of their Europa League second qualifying round tie.
A Ross Forbes goal gave the Steelmen a slim advantage for next week's return, but Brown believes that his side can ensure further progress.
He commented: "I'm happy we didn't concede, which is important in Europe. One of the prime objectives was to make sure we kept a clean sheet.
"You could see the emphasis I put on not conceding. We usually bring Mark Reynolds up for corner-kicks, but because of his pace at the back, we didn't.
"I'm convinced we'll manage to score up there. I would like to have got a bigger lead and we have got to be very respectful of the Icelandic side because they played well.
"We lacked a bit of sharpness in front of goal, but one of the benefits of playing our first competitive game is that we'll get a bit more sharpness and fitness."
